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
The Problem with Authority
Search
Sponsored
·
Your Podcast. Everywhere. Effortlessly.
Share. Educate. Inspire. Entertain. You do you. We'll handle the rest.
→
Paolo Fragomeni
September 26, 2013
Technology
0
210
The Problem with Authority
The Problem with Authority in Distributed Systems (For Nodeconf.eu)
Paolo Fragomeni
September 26, 2013
Tweet
Share
More Decks by Paolo Fragomeni
See All by Paolo Fragomeni
Fireflies, Ants and Bees! Mother Nature builds effective, fault tolerant, distributed systems!
hij1nx
0
280
Node Dublin
hij1nx
0
390
Thinking distributed
hij1nx
1
310
Other Decks in Technology
See All in Technology
SREじゃなかった僕らがenablingを通じて「SRE実践者」になるまでのリアル / SRE Kaigi 2026
aeonpeople
6
2.3k
Introduction to Sansan for Engineers / エンジニア向け会社紹介
sansan33
PRO
6
68k
Amazon S3 Vectorsを使って資格勉強用AIエージェントを構築してみた
usanchuu
3
450
ZOZOにおけるAI活用の現在 ~開発組織全体での取り組みと試行錯誤~
zozotech
PRO
5
5.5k
Bedrock PolicyでAmazon Bedrock Guardrails利用を強制してみた
yuu551
0
230
セキュリティについて学ぶ会 / 2026 01 25 Takamatsu WordPress Meetup
rocketmartue
1
300
All About Sansan – for New Global Engineers
sansan33
PRO
1
1.3k
SREが向き合う大規模リアーキテクチャ 〜信頼性とアジリティの両立〜
zepprix
0
450
MCPでつなぐElasticsearchとLLM - 深夜の障害対応を楽にしたい / Bridging Elasticsearch and LLMs with MCP
sashimimochi
0
170
GitLab Duo Agent Platform × AGENTS.md で実現するSpec-Driven Development / GitLab Duo Agent Platform × AGENTS.md
n11sh1
0
140
小さく始めるBCP ― 多プロダクト環境で始める最初の一歩
kekke_n
1
410
学生・新卒・ジュニアから目指すSRE
hiroyaonoe
2
610
Featured
See All Featured
Jess Joyce - The Pitfalls of Following Frameworks
techseoconnect
PRO
1
65
RailsConf & Balkan Ruby 2019: The Past, Present, and Future of Rails at GitHub
eileencodes
141
34k
Designing for Performance
lara
610
70k
Build The Right Thing And Hit Your Dates
maggiecrowley
38
3k
The Psychology of Web Performance [Beyond Tellerrand 2023]
tammyeverts
49
3.3k
職位にかかわらず全員がリーダーシップを発揮するチーム作り / Building a team where everyone can demonstrate leadership regardless of position
madoxten
57
50k
The Cost Of JavaScript in 2023
addyosmani
55
9.5k
Automating Front-end Workflow
addyosmani
1371
200k
Conquering PDFs: document understanding beyond plain text
inesmontani
PRO
4
2.3k
How to Ace a Technical Interview
jacobian
281
24k
Responsive Adventures: Dirty Tricks From The Dark Corners of Front-End
smashingmag
254
22k
Testing 201, or: Great Expectations
jmmastey
46
8k
Transcript
The problem with Authority BUREAUCRACY, CORPORATE INFLUENCE & TRUST Thursday,
September 26, 13
massive amounts of software & data We create Thursday, September
26, 13
& widely distributed We want it to be highly available
Thursday, September 26, 13
the authenticity & origin of things We want to validate
Thursday, September 26, 13
Today we have A BUREAUCRACY & A TECHNICAL QUANDARY Thursday,
September 26, 13
We can’t solve problems with the same level of thinking
that created them. “ A Nice Quote from some smart person Thursday, September 26, 13
Reputation Systems PKI, SPKI, SDSI... Thursday, September 26, 13
Try to define identity Thursday, September 26, 13
Try to replicate identity Thursday, September 26, 13
␡ Try to revoke identity Thursday, September 26, 13
✓ Try to define policies Thursday, September 26, 13
Sybil attacks Revocation lists Replication Latency Financial Concerns Problems in
reputation systems ␡ Thursday, September 26, 13
How should we define Identity? WITHOUT CENTRALIZED AUTHORITY Thursday, September
26, 13
Social networks define identity as behaviors & interactions over time
Thursday, September 26, 13
public & private key cryptography Simple tools for Thursday, September
26, 13
data & software to actual authors Let’s start mapping Thursday,
September 26, 13
github.com/hij1nx/pkp Thursday, September 26, 13
hash (data) public key URLs cert = sign(private key, meta)
meta { Thursday, September 26, 13
hash(data) = cert.hash + verify(public key, cert) Thursday, September 26,
13
Twitter Thursday, September 26, 13
/ hij1nx ! " fin Thursday, September 26, 13